KELLER'S TNA IMPACT REPORT 3/6: Christian vs. Angle in cage, Tomko vs. Joe first blood, Nash vs. Styles
Mar 9, 2008 - 6:16:34 PM


By Wade Keller, Torch editor

KELLER'S TNA IMPACT REPORT
MARCH 6, 2008
AIRED ON SPIKE TV - TAPED IN ORLANDO, FLA.


WHAT HAPPENED: 1ST HOUR

-The show opened with highlights of key storyline advancements from last week's show including Kurt Angle tossed wife Karen Angle to the floor. The show is titled "Fighting for the Edge."

-Backstage, Jeremy Borash held the mic for Kurt Angle as he gave A.J. Styles and Tomko a pep talk about their chance to get the edge in the six-man tag on Sunday. Styles asked where Karen was. Angle scolded him for worrying about Karen with so much on the line for the Angle Alliance. Angle said she's at home. Styles said he tried to call her. Tomko laughed. Angle didn't like her calling his wife. Styles said according to Karen, she's married to both of them. Angle told him to take off his stupid crown. He told him the key to taking Kevin Nash out is taking out his knees. He told Tomko that he needs to make Samoa Joe blood. He said, "Samoans love to bleed, so make him bleed." He said tonight they'll make history.

-After the Impact opening aired, Jim Cornette stood mid-ring and announced the three big main event singles matches with stips added to each. It's a bit sad that the three matches they announced probably would have sold more PPVs than the plain ol' six-man involving all three. Cornette said the team that wins two out of three singles matches tonight will enter the match with an advantage. He didn't elaborate. Cornette then introduced Booker T. Cornette asked Booker about his match against Robert Roode in a ten-foot leather strap match with a special stip that if Roode wins, Peyton Banks can strap Traci Brooks ten times and if Booker wins, vice-versa. As Booker was about to talk about "that chicken-head," Roode's music played and he and Banks stepped out onto the stage.

Roode said, "Screw you Cornette and you Booker T." He added the fans into that as they chanted "you suck." Roode said it's against his moral fiber to partake in a match with a stipulation that leads to a woman getting strapped. West said, "Moral fiber? He broke Sharmell's jaw and he can care less." (He meant he could NOT care less. I don't get why people get that backwards, especially professional broadcasters.) Roode added, "Stop hiding behind your skanks, stop hiding behind your wife, stop hiding behind Traci, and for once in your life be a man and fight your own damn battles." Cornette's facial reactions next to Booker added to the impression Roode's comments were making. Booker charged out of the ring and met Roode in the aisle. They had a pullapart brawl with security and Matt Morton intervening.

-Crystal interviewed Kevin Nash, Samoa Joe, and Christian Cage. She said if they win two out of three matches, the Angle Alliance have to start short-handed. Joe said there's no escaping the match without bleeding first. Christian said they may not be friends, but they've come to an understanding and they understand business. He said they're working the system. He said their way may not always be popular with everyone. He said Cornette cringes when he hears a knock on his door that it might be one of them knocking. He said he's returning the favor against Angle in a cage for costing him the World Title twice. He closed with, "If you don't know, now you know." Nash said he can't follow Christian's promo, but then he broke into a Hulk Hogan-style promo that cracked up Christian and Joe. "Whatcha gonna do when the Kevster and his 17-times surgically repaired knees come down on you."

1 -- KEVIN NASH vs. A.J. STYLES

The two entered in jeans and a t-shirt. Styles charged at Nash, who swatted him away. Nash took Styles down with several punches, knocking Styles to the floor. Nash followed, ramming Styles into the railing. They fought into the crowd where Nash gave Styles a series of kneelifts. They cut away for a commercial.

[Commercial Break]

Back from the break, Styles had Nash on his knees inside the ring. They showed a clip from during the break of Styles flying at Nash with an elbow to take control followed by ramming Nash's head into the steps. Nash came back with a side slam for a two count. Nash lifted and dropped Styles face-first over the top turnbuckle. Nash lited Styles for a Jackknife, but dropped him as his left knee buckled. Styles dove off the top rope at Nash, but Nash caught him and chokeslammed him for the three count.

WINNER: Nash in 7:00.

STAR RATING: 1/2* -- Three of the seven minutes were cut out for a commercial, but what aired didn't add up to much. The idea that Styles lost to an opponent who appeared practically crippled isn't a positive. The idea seemed to be to make it seem like a fluke, but Styles looked weak by going down clean to Nash after he could barely stand seconds earlier.

3 -- TOMKO vs. SAMOA JOE - First Blood Match

Joe went right after Tomko at ringside to jump-start the match. Joe rammed Tomko head-first into the announcers' table. Tomko swung at Joe with the bell ringing hammer, but Joe ducked and threw Tomko into the ringpost. Tomko slammed Joe onto the rampway a minute later, then swung a chair, but Joe moved. Joe piledrove Tomko on the ramp. Tomko sold an impact on his head, although it didn't really look like his head hit any steel. Joe rolled Tomko into the ring. Tomko came back with a surprise clothesline on Joe in the ring.

WHAT HAPPENED: 2ND HOUR

Tomko propped a chair in the corner and threw Joe toward it, but Joe stopped short and instead used a drop toe hold to send Tomko face-first into it. Tomko held a chair, but Joe kicked it into his face before Tomko could swing it. Tomko seconds later swung the chair at Joe. Joe blocked it with his arm. Joe then locked Tomko into a rear naked choke and forced a tapout. The ref called for the bell. There was brief confusion. The ref pointed at the blood on Joe's arm from blocking the chairshot and then raised Tomko's arm.

WINNER: Tomko in 6:00.

STAR RATING: *3/4 -- Good intensity and high-impact work throughout what was a relatively short first-blood match. The whole thing was in third gear, but appropriately so given what was at stake and the stips of the match. The finish was well done, too. Clever and logical.

4 -- JUDAS MESIAS (w/James Mitchell) vs. RHINO

Tenay and West talked about how Abyss has gone missing for several weeks since he unmasked on Impact. They said the emotional toll Mitchell's revelation took on him was too much. In the end, Mesias missed a top rope splash. Rhino then hit the Gore for the win. After the match, James Storm snuck up behind Rhino and superkicked him and then leaned over and trash-talked him.

WINNER: Rhino in 4:00.

STAR RATING: 1/2* -- Mostly a stand-up brawl. A strong win for Rhino headed into the PPV, but it cheapens everything about Mitchell's "monsters" to have then job so often in such short matches, especially when it's treated as the expected outcome and no big deal when it happens time after time. Tenay and West needed to sell this as a bigger deal for Rhino to beat Mesias in such a short match.

6 -- CHRISTIAN CAGE vs. KURT ANGLE - Six-Sides of Steel Cage Match

The match was joined in progress, and three minutes into it - with Angle in control - they cut to another break.

[Commercial Break]

At 10:00, Christian took Angle down with an inverted DDT. When he climbed the cage, Angle met him up there and went for a belly-to-belly. Christian blocked it and shoved Angle to the mat, then hit a frog splash. At 12:00 Angle tried to back suplex Christian off the top rope. Christian held onto the cage and eventually elbowed Angle to break free. He tried to climb over the top of the cage, but Angle gave him an Olympic Slam off the top to the mat. The crowd chanted "TNA, TNA." Christian scurried for the open door to escape, but Angle grabbed his leg and applied an ankle lock. Angle went for another Olympic slam, but Christian countered with an Unprettier, but Angle blocked it and then hit two German suplexes. Christian blocked the third attempt and countered with a backdrop that flipped Angle to the mat. At 15:00 Angle applied an anklelock while Christian was on the top rope. Christian flipped off of the top rope to escape, and it sent Angle crashing to the mat, too. Christian crawled to the cage door. Ref Earl Hebner opened it for him. Angle knocked Christian down, awkwardly tying up his leg into the ropes. Angle beat on Christian and then tried to crawl out of the door. Christian held on to him. Angle instead decided to climb the cage instead. He got to the top and raised his arms in victory. Christian escaped the ropes and met Angle on top. He crawled over and began climbing down with Angle. They both fell to the ground while tied up together. Tenay said it's a high-stakes judgment call. Hebner ruled that Christian hit the floor first.

WINNER: Christian in 17:00.

STAR RATING: ***1/2 -- Good cage match.

-Afterward, Tomko and Styles joined Angle in beating up Christian inside the cage with the door locked. Joe and Nash tried to make the save, but couldn't get the door open. Neither would be mistake for Spiderman, so they didn't climb the cage. Joe bashed the lock with a chair as Angle had Christian in an anklelock in mid-ring as they cut away to a final video promoting Elevation X. It seemed out of character for Tomko to take part in such a gang attack. His character just has no constitution and it's going to hurt his ability to be a breakout star this year.
